My son, Enrique, and I found a group of 10 pigs around 1pm this past Sat during the H.A.M. hunt. We had to wait them out on an opposite ridge until 2:15 for the wind to cooperated. Once the wind was steady we dropped down into the wash, removed our boots and started the stalk. My son (12) was unable to handle the thorns in his feet so I went on without him with hopes after shooting mine the herd would run down directly to him. 15 minutes later I shot my pig @ 12 yards quartering away. He died so fast the rest of the herd never spooked. I started walking around and eventually called down to my son to meet me on the ridgetop. While I sat ther barefoot removing cholla from my feet I called in a pig to 2 FEET and captured it all on video. Once Enrique arrived I showed him the footage and he said we get to get back on that herd. It didn't take long and we were on their trail. The first one I called into 17 yards, but never presented a shot for my boy. We trailed the herd and eventually wound up with a pig @ 15 yards slightly quartering away. That was all he needed as he placed a perfect arrow where it needed to be. This is Enrique's first bow kill. It's a great feeling when your kids are successful. A couple of things that I disagree with from previous posts that I have encountered after shooting a lot through my d.b. matrix: 1) your mesh does not need to be tight. It can be a little loose and you will not hinder broadhead flight. The double bull video explains this as well. 2) most mechanicals will shoot fine through the mesh. I have shot rocket steelheads and grim reapers and a couple others with no problems. I would not shoot a rage through the mesh.

Don't get frustrated and give up. You're almost there. Now with Google earth, internet and hard maps 75% of your scouting can be done in your living room on the computer and telephone. You live in New River. You're 7 hrs away - that's not that far! Plan your camping trips and vacations in 13b. Shoot out there Friday after work and sleep in your truck for the weekend (it's cheap scouting). Sorry if the family doesn't like it, but this is a once in a lifetime tag - be selfish! Spend tons of time online looking at threads regarding this unit and contact everyone you can for help that has been there. Admit now, you are not ready for this tag. So with that being said buy a point for this year and use this upcoming year to get yourself ready. Plan ahead and stick to your plan. Believe me guides are familiar with deer herds, but don't know of every buck in a unit and knowing OF a buck and killing it is completely different. No disrespect to any guides, but I prefer DIY. Do what makes you comfortable, but make a decision and stick to it. Learn the country, scout, due-diligence, find your buck, make the stalk, kill the buck - or - pay the guide to do all that for you (except sqeezing the trigger / release).
